Transaction e391232e49adfc024ab376d2ed94f941f79bd0b03287e73b23e40f944c0e1b30

1 Input
2 Outputs
  • e391232e49adfc024ab376d2ed94f941f79bd0b03287e73b23e40f944c0e1b30:0
  • value  4762304
    address  1BKx74DPCyue472taA3yXr8v2sPnb8f6tZ
  • e391232e49adfc024ab376d2ed94f941f79bd0b03287e73b23e40f944c0e1b30:1
  • value  16634851
    address  1MduCHc9ALwP6EbXyrewCYKeU4YJdnjNSa